Juanita Cornett of Beckley passed away peacefully on February 6, 2021 surrounded by her loving family. She was born June 14, 1953 to the late Jim and Unavell Chambers. She was also preceded in death by her brother, Jim Lewis Chambers.
Those left to cherish her memories are her loving husband of 47 years, Richard L. Cornett II; sons, Dr. Stuart Cornett (Amy), Todd Cornett (Rachel), Ricky Cornett (Kelsey); sister, Joetta Oliver (Tim). She was blessed with 9 grandchildren; Baylei, Kennedy, Rylei, Jordan, Todd II, Tristan, Chino, Kaylin, Mia; great grandchildren; Layla, Eastyn, Joseph, Lynnlei; sisters-in-law, Nancy Chambers, Karen Gibson, and Kittye Fink (Donnie); her dear friend, Frances Moye; and numerous other wonderful family members and friends.
Juanita’s greatest joy was being with her family. She was a generous soul with a heart of gold.
Rick and Juanita founded Jan Care Ambulance Service in 1970. With the support of their family, Jan Care has grown to be the largest Ambulance provider in West Virginia.
